Department of Labor Resumes Processing for Temporary and Permanent Employment Applications |
|
The Department of Labor (DOL) announced that it has resumed processing applications for prevailing wage determinations, labor condition applications (LCAs), and PERM, H-2A and H-2B labor certifications. The Foreign Labor Application Gateway (FLAG) system is also accessible and can now be used to submit new applications.
DOL hasn’t issued guidance for the late filing of PERM applications. In the past, they’ve provided a grace period, and hopefully they will do the same now. We will provide an update when it becomes available.

DHS Terminates Automatic Extensions for Employment Authorization Documents |
|
USCIS announced that it will no longer automatically extend an individual’s employment authorization document (EAD) after an application for renewal is filed.
The interim final rule by the Department of Homeland Security explains that this change is meant to increase screening and vetting for foreign nationals living and working in the United States. Those submitting EAD renewal applications will now undergo additional security screening before their extension is approved.
The rule is effective October 30, 2025, and will not apply to any EAD extensions filed before this date. USCIS emphasized the importance of filing a timely EAD renewal (within 180 days of its expiration) to avoid a temporary break in a person’s ability to work within the United States.

Note: This rule does not apply to STEM OPT EAD extensions. STEM OPT extension applications (timely filed) will automatically extend EADs for 180 days. |
